Well, here's the shocker: substation cabinets physically cannot store energy. These metal enclosures primarily house circuit breakers, transformers, and monitoring equipment - components designed for power distribution, not storage. Hosting capacity refers to how much distributed solar a local feeder or transformer can accept without causing voltage, thermal, or protection issues. . This interactive map illustrates solar PV hosting capacity for Central Hudson Gas & Electric's distribution circuits. Hosting capacity is an estimate of the amount of DER that may be accommodated without adversely impacting power quality or reliability under current circuit configurations and. . NLR's advanced hosting capacity analysis can help utilities, policymakers, and solar developers better understand the impact of adding new distributed photovoltaic (DPV) systems to the electrical distribution system.
